Job summary

Firefly Aerospace is offering year-round internship opportunities at our launch site in Vandenberg, CA. We welcome current undergraduates and recent graduates to join the Launch Team to support pad upgrades, data automation, and other critical tasks to keep a live launch site operational.

Candidates should have focus areas such as Mechanical Design, Electrical Engineering, Fluid Systems, Propulsion, or Software Development.

Qualifications

  • Must be enrolled in BS/MS program or recent graduate in engineering/science/m mathematics.
  • Degree focus: engineering, mathematics or science; hands-on environment.

Responsibilities

  • Solve launch site problems (electrical, mechanical, fluids or operations) to meet launch needs.
  • Perform engineering behind technical solutions including design reviews, build instructions, fabrication, testing and documentation updates.
  • Create review and release procedures to support engineering on the launch pad.
  • Perform on‑pad operations and interface with range to meet documentation requirements and standards.
  • Apply engineering principles to develop novel solutions for challenging problems in internship focus areas.
  • Assist with static fire and launch activities as directed by the launch director.

ABOUT FIREFLY AEROSPACE

Firefly Aerospace is a space and defense technology company on a mission to reliably and repeatedly launch land and operate space systems from Earth to the Moon and beyond As the partner of choice for critical space missions Firefly is the first commercial company to launch a satellite to orbit with 24 hour notice and the first company to achieve a successful Moon landing Headquartered in North Austin Texas Firefly is looking for passionate hardworking innovators to join our team and help fuel our successful trajectory into space
